So, to deal with being stuck inside I have begun expanding my pallet. Found a decent wine, Back Home Again Red Wine. Very light as red goes, sweet but not oppressively so, and under twenty bucks. Overall would recommend. Anyway go go gadget wine thread.

Yesterday I opened and thoroughly enjoyed the last 1961 Château Brane-Cantenac from my collection. It was absolutely devine even though it was probably just past its peak. There was the typical Margaux velvety glove as well as rich ripe fruit from the nose all the way through to the finish. This was definitely an almost perfect time to enjoy this jewel as I know it was just going to diminish from this point on. Brane-Cantenac is also the first Bordeaux I ever purchased as a 1971 vintage back many years ago when I first got serious about wine.

Pandemic Playtime: The Icrontic Grand Prix
Get your wheels, controllers and keyboards prepped. Radio your pit crew. Icrontic is going racing this Wednesday, April 22nd at 8pm ET (7CT 6PT) with RaceRoom Racing Experience.

It's a free racing simulator that's welcoming to all levels of players, even those new to racing sims. No special equipment is needed just show up and blast around a few tracks with us.
Each race track will have a 10 minute practice round, 5 minutes to get in a qualifying lap and a 20 minute race. We have 4 tracks to play on and a few car choices. Everyone will be racing in a similar car to keep things fair. The game itself has all kinds of driving assistance built-in so you can talor the racing to your level and I have the server set to allow user choice of driving aids.
The game itself is fairly large so if you plan of participation (40gb) and I would recommend downloading it in advance. I'll update this thread (and discord) with the server information tomorrow.

"For many of us, I don't think it's "grumpiness", it's "it will cost $1000 to play this game""
This is, for the most part, untrue in 2020. The Oculus Rift Quest is all-in-one and costs less than an Xbox and it doesn't need a PC to play at all. With the newly released link cable, you can plug it into your PC and play Rift S quality games while still having the flexibility of play where you want when you want it. I know $400 isn't cheap, but we're far and away from the days of needing $1,200+ worth of upgrades and hardware to be able to play.
VR runs great on mid-tier PC hardware these days. It runs fine on a GeForce 1080, so if you've upgraded or rebuilt your PC in the last four years, you're probably good to go already. As the hardware has improved, the software has also lowered the previously insane high requirements to be able to play VR on your PC.
It also helps that most VR games are priced accordingly. You won't find $60 games - most are around the $15 dollar price point. If a game is more of an hour long experience, you'll typically pay an amount that makes sense for what it is.
